    Brabus Create 700HP Solar Beam Mercedes G63 AMG

    The Mercedes G63 AMG is certainly no stranger to the Brabus treatment but when you start with a “Crazy Color” example and then slap on the Widestar kit, you have quite the head-turner of a G-Wagon. The yellow is called Solar Beam and it actually works pretty damn well with the carbon elements around the car.

    Among the changes sits a vented hood with a carbon fiber central area and a beefier front bumper with bigger air intakes and an extra set of LED daytime running lights. Brabus also installed massive 23-inch forged wheels with Yokohama rubber, custom headlights with a black tint, roof-mounted rear spoiler, and vented rear fenders. The interior was not left undone and and got illuminated door sills, black leather upholstery with yellow stitching, Alcantara headliner, and a sportier pedal set. Tuning is typical Brabus style as the 5.5-litre V8 has been bumped up from 571 horses to 700 horses allowing the beast to hit 100 km/h in just 4.9 seconds.
